随着互联网的不断发展,拥有一个属于自己的网站已经成为许多人和企业的需求。但是,对于很多新手来说,网站建设的过程可能显得有些复杂和神秘。本文将详细介绍自己建设网站的具体流程,帮助你从零开始搭建一个个性化的网站。

一、明确网站的目标和需求

在开始网站建设之前,首先需要明确网站的目的、目标用户、功能模块以及内容结构。这一步是整个网站建设过程的基础,决定了后续步骤的方向和重点。你可以通过以下问题来帮助自己明确需求:

  1. 网站的主要目的是什么?是为了展示公司形象、销售产品、提供信息服务还是其他?
  2. 目标用户是谁?他们有哪些需求和偏好?
  3. 网站需要哪些功能模块?如首页、关于我们、产品介绍、新闻资讯、联系我们等。
  4. 网站的设计风格和色彩搭配有何要求?
  5. 是否需要与第三方系统集成,如支付系统、社交媒体等?

二、选择域名和主机

域名是网站在互联网上的唯一标识,一个好的域名可以增加用户的访问率。在选择域名时,应尽量简洁明了、易于记忆,并且与网站的主题相关。例如,如果你的网站是一个美食博客,可以选择类似“deliciousfood.com”的域名。

主机是存放网站文件和运行程序的地方。选择一个合适的主机服务提供商非常重要,它将直接影响网站的访问速度和稳定性。常见的主机类型有虚拟主机、VPS、云服务器等,你可以根据自己的需求和预算进行选择。

三、设计和开发网站

设计阶段

网站的视觉效果对用户体验至关重要。如果你没有设计经验,可以使用一些现成的模板或者请专业的设计师来完成这一部分。在设计过程中,需要注意以下几点:

  1. 用户体验:网站的设计应该符合用户的浏览习惯,导航清晰,操作简便。
  2. 响应式设计:确保网站在不同设备(如电脑、手机、平板)上都能正常显示和使用。
  3. SEO优化:合理的布局和代码结构可以提高搜索引擎的友好度,有助于提升网站的排名。

开发阶段

在完成设计后,就需要进入开发阶段了。这一阶段包括前端开发和后端开发两部分。

  • 前端开发:主要负责页面的展示效果,使用HTML、CSS、JavaScript等技术来实现设计师的效果。
  • 后端开发:主要负责数据处理和业务逻辑,常用的技术有PHP、Python、Java等。根据网站的功能需求选择合适的框架进行开发。

四、测试和上线

在完成开发后,不要急于发布网站,而是需要进行全面测试。测试的内容包括但不限于功能测试、性能测试、兼容性测试等。确保所有功能都能正常工作,并且在不同的浏览器和设备上都有良好的表现。

测试完成后,就可以将网站部署到主机上并正式上线了。此时,还需要配置DNS解析,将域名指向你的主机地址。

五、运营和维护

网站上线后,并不意味着工作的结束。持续的运营和维护同样重要。你需要定期更新内容、监控网站状态、备份数据等。此外,还可以通过分析工具了解用户的行为和需求,不断优化网站的功能和服务。

自己建设网站并不是一件容易的事情,但只要按照上述步骤逐步推进,相信你也可以打造出一个满意的个人或企业形象展示平台。希望这篇文章对你有所帮助!